Description OKUMURA N. Shin-ya 2004-10-27 07:40:22 UTC
Man-pages-1.6x.tar.bz2 includes './man-pages-1.6?/POSIX-COPYRIGHT', which is copyright notice of The OpenGroup originated man pages, such as man0p, man1p and man3p.  I consider man-pages-1.6x.ebuild should be modified as;  - dodoc man-pages-*.Announce README + dodoc man-pages-*.Announce README POSIX-COPYRIGHT  Because POSIX-COPYRIGHT seems not conflict GPL-2, LICENSE do not have to be modified. (or add 'as-is')

Comment 1 SpanKY gentoo-dev 2004-10-27 11:48:10 UTC
why ?
COPYRIGHT / LICENSE specific files are normally neglected from dodoc
